Off-Peak & Super-Off Peak train tickets
Off-Peak tickets are cheaper and more flexible, allowing for travel during less busy times. Super Off-Peak tickets are even cheaper and are perfect for less conventional schedules.
Learn MoreReturn train tickets
Valid for both an outward and return journey from the same destination on your chosen route.
Learn MoreAdvance train tickets
Typically the most cost-effective option for train travel. They are usually available for purchase 12 weeks before the travel date.
Learn MoreSeason train tickets
Season tickets allow unlimited travel between two stations and can save you more than 1/3 on train fares.

Save More on Wolverhampton to Liverpool Train Fares
Book in Advance
Advanced train tickets are typically the most cost-effective option for train travel. They are usually available for purchase 12 weeks before the travel date.
Group Travel
Get a 1/3 discount on Off-Peak tickets through GroupSave if you are travelling with a group of 3 to 9 adults.
Season Tickets
A weekly or monthly train pass which includes unlimited travel between two stations. It could help you save more than 1/3 on train fares.
Flexi Travel
8 days of unlimited travel between two stations within a 28-day period.

In general, the off-peak period typically starts after 09:30 and excludes the evening rush hours of 15:30–18:15 for travel to and from major cities. The specific times may differ depending on the route and train company, but generally, you can expect off-peak times to fall outside the usual commuting hours. For Transport for London, off-peak times are observed on weekdays from the first service until 06:30, from 09:30 to 16:00, and after 19:00.
